T-Mobile HD2

T-Mobile is about to introduce the world's thinnest smartphone with the largest screen available. It is the HTC HD2, a US variant of the wildly popular HD2 in European markets. The smartphone is graced with a 1 Gz processor and a screen thats boasts a display of 800 x 480 pixels. Preloaded are applications for blockbuster, Windows Marketplace, Office Mobile, Opera Mini Browser and so much more. Here are some specs straight from HTC:

T-Mobile HD2


  • Immerse yourself. This screen is our biggest yet, 4.3 inches corner to corner, with bright, lifelike 480x800 resolution.
  • Keep up with people, don't keep track of messages. See all your conversations with someone—from calls and e-mails to text messages and Facebook®status updates—all together, all in one place.
  • Make your home your own. Change your home screen to create the perfect phone for you, with your apps and interests right on top.
  • Be a weather watcher. The HD2 automatically checks the local weather, and then shows you what to expect with animated weather wallpaper.
  • Keep in touch the way you want. Stay close to friends on Facebook, Google Talk™, and Flickr®. Master your tweets with HTC Peep™.
  • Do everything faster. Qualcomm’s latest processor, the new 1GHz Snapdragon™, speeds up everything—from playing games to watching shows to opening files from work.

T-Mobile Announces the BlackBerry Bold 9700 with 3G

Do you really think so?

via Phonescoop.com

Today T-Mobile announced it's first 3G BlackBerry, the Bold 9700. The 9700 will support voice calls over both cellular and Wi-Fi networks. It also brings the optical trackpad first seen on the 8520 to a higher-end device. It also has a new 624MHz processor, built in GPS, 3.2 megapixel camera with autofocus and flash and support for microSD cards up to 32GB. The T-Mobile version will have quad-band GSM/EDGE radios and 900/1700/2100MHz HSDPA. It will be available before the shopping season for $200 with new contract.

Motorola Cliq-T-Mobile Customers Get Ready!!

Do you really think so?


     Photo courtesy of Engadgetmobile.com                                                           

T-Mobile is set to launch the new Motorola Cliq with Motoblur. What's Motoblur you ask? It is a new optimized overlay. This handset will run Android 1.5 for all of you robot fans. Here are some specs:

T-Mobile USA will carry it (date/price unknown beyond 4Q)
Full Touchscreen with FULL QWERTY side slider
320 x 480 pixel screen resolution
Android 1.5 (Cupcake)
5MP camera with auto-focus
3.5mm headset jack
MicroSD up to 32GB support
1420 mAh battery
Syncs contacts, posts, messages, photos and much more—from sources such as Facebook®, MySpace, Twitter, Gmail™, work and personal e-mail, and LastFM
5 stellar homescreen widgets to keep you always in-the-know: Happenings, Messages, Social Status, News Feeds, Calendar… plus your widgets from Android Market
MOTO Blur account allows you to back up your contacts/data, find a lost phone and easily integrate your existing contact info for friends/family/business

Apple Introduces a range of new products Up first-The Nano with Video Recording

Do you really think so?
Apple had their usual fall keynote address this morning. Steve Jobs was back at the helm and looked as healthy as he always has. The iPod Classic and Touch received spec improvements along with price drops.
The big news was the iPod Nano. It is still packaged in the same slim design but now includes a video recorder. Yes, with a built in mic and speakers. Another first-FM RADIO. I never thought I'd see the day Aplpe would bend over and take it. Yes, folks, consumer demand rules!!!
